Foreign Ministry: Two Romanians injured in Turkey road accident transferred to private hospital

Publicat:

Two Romanian citizens injured in the road accident occurred in Turkey on March 14 were transferred on Wednesday from the public hospital in Manavgat to a private hospital in Antalya for additional medical investigations.
